

About this home
The romantic, quiet 20 sqm studio with a view of Berlin's roofs is located in one of the most historic factory floors in Berlin: formerly home to the first gay museum, in the 90s techno club, later wild creative artists had their studios there. Today the building is a "forgotten sleeping beauty", but Kreuzberg nights rage outside the door: the famous Bergmannstrasse is full of alternative and stylishly authentic cafés, bars, restaurants and the well known market hall with culinary delicacies
